MAYOR'S CORNER
| | Greetings!
There was a huge crowd at the new Baylor-Scott & White Hospital on Highways 71 at 281 for the ribbon cutting Tuesday evening. What a beautiful facility! It is not yet open for business, but it will be next week. It took no more than 15 minutes from my driveway to the hospital's front door (and I had to stop for all of the lights). So now we have two major hospitals within a very short drive of the neighborhood. And that works both ways - we also have a number of hospital and professional building employees who have found out what a great place Meadowlakes is to live.
Work is in progress at the Hidden Falls Restaurant - new windows and flooring in the main dining room, removal of the outside part of the chimney that continued to leak, no matter what we did, repainting the walls, etc. The beautiful stone fireplace will remain on the inside, but without real wood-burning capability. Completion is targeted for no later than mid-August. In the meantime, great food and drink service are available as usual in the bar area and on the patio - and smaller meetings and card groups continue as usual in the Pecan Room just inside the newly installed front door. The Pro Shop is not affected by these changes.
Mary Ann Raesener Mayor

POA BOARD MEMBERS NEEDED
| | The POA is already getting ready for the Annual Meeting, Saturday, October 10th. There are two positions available on the board. There are three ways to place your name on the ballot.
1.) Submit your name to the nominating committee by August 1st by contacting one of the following:
Bob Brown (512) 659-4000 Marie Hammond (830) 693-9738 Patti Wray (830) 798-0395
2.) Submit a petition, signed by at least 10 members in good standing, to the POA secretary by August 21st.
3.) Nominate a person from the floor at the Annual Meeting provided that person has agreed to be nominated.
Thank you for your interest and please consider serving on the POA board.

GOLF CART REGULATIONS
| |  The City has received lots complaints of unlicensed drivers operating golf carts. Remember that in order to operate a golf cart you must be a licensed driver or be accompanied by a licensed driver. Please click here to see the ordinance.
Also, don't forget that your golf cart must be registered at the City office in order to operate it on the city streets.
We appreciate your cooperation on these matters. |
